Where does “kankipalmikko” come from?
kankipalmikko (Finnish) comes from Finnish kanki, from Proto-Finnic kanki — bar, lever.
kankipalmikko (Finnish): queue men's hairstyle with a stiff braid or ponytail at the back of the head
